In conclusion, the Altec Lansing ADA series was more than just a set of speakers; it was a declaration that computer audio mattered. By leveraging professional acoustic principles in a consumer package, Altec Lansing transformed the PC from a productivity tool into a multimedia hub. While modern audio has moved toward wireless streaming and soundbars, the principles established by the ADA series—the importance of a dedicated subwoofer, the manipulation of room acoustics for a wider soundstage, and the necessity of high-quality components—remain the foundation of high-fidelity audio today. The ADA series stands as a monument to a time when innovation in sound was physical and tangible, creating a legacy that still resonates. altec lansing ada
